The Role

We are in search of a Director – Energy Policy, who will serve as a senior policy analyst for institutional investor clients, largely hedge funds.  The position is responsible for developing high-quality investment ideas based on rigorous policy analysis and for consistently covering policy developments across the energy sector for our capital markets clients.  The ideal candidate will have exceptional analytical and communication skills, and a demonstrated interest in energy investing and energy policy.  A successful candidate will be a highly qualified professional with at least 12 years of experience in policy research for institutional investors, energy equity research, investment banking, buy-side investing or a related field.   

Title may be adjusted based on experience. 

Responsibilities include: 

  • Analyzing the risks and opportunities presented to publicly traded securities by public policy (including but not limited to regulation, legislation, government enforcement, and litigation) 
  • Developing market-leading coverage across the energy sector - including clean energy, oil & gas, infrastructure & industrials, metals & mining, power & utilities, and clean fuels & transportation.  
  • Authoring high-quality research reports and presentations for Capstone’s capital markets clients (hedge funds, mutual funds and private credit investors)  
  • Responding to questions from capital markets clients in a thoughtful and timely manner 
  • Hosting high-quality client conference calls and in-person events, including in-person marketing trips 

Qualifications 

Successful candidates will possess the following attributes: 

  • Demonstrated expertise within the energy sector, including clean energy, oil & gas, infrastructure & industrials, metals & mining and clean fuels & transportation. 
  • Ability to communicate complex ideas to clients – in-person, remotely and in writing through value-additive research reports 
  • Strong client servicing and interpersonal skills 
  • The ability to develop and discern high-quality, value-oriented investment ideas  
  • Ability to self-motivate, work independently, and thrive in a fast-paced work environment 
  • Passion for combining government policy with investing 

Education and Experience Requirements: 

  • Four-year bachelor’s degree required 
  • Graduate degree or CFA preferred 
  • At least 12 years of experience in policy research for institutional investors, energy equity research, investment banking, buy-side investing or a related field 
  • High academic achievement  
  • Strong MS Excel skills  
  • Must be eligible to work in the US without employer sponsorship

Capstone is a leading Washington, DC-based policy analysis and regulatory due diligence firm, which advises institutional investors – hedge funds, private equity firms, and mutual funds – and companies on how public policy impacts investments, companies and business decisions. Our firm balances sophisticated policy and investment analysis in the healthcare, financial services, energy, TMT, and national security/defense sectors, and advises some of the largest and most sophisticated institutional investors and companies in the U.S. and Europe.

Capstone offers a competitive benefits package, including health, vision, dental insurance, paid vacation, travel stipend and 401(k). The expected compensation for this role will be $190,000+ base salary plus bonus, commensurate with experience.

This position is based in our Washington, DC office. Capstone is in-person Monday thru Thursday with flexible work from home Fridays.

What We Do

Capstone is a global strategy firm helping corporations, industries, and investors navigate the local, national, and international policy and regulatory landscape. With offices in Washington, DC, Houston, London, Brussels, and Sydney, our work explores how policy affects companies, industries, and investments in the financial services, health care, TMT, and energy sectors. We work with a diverse group of corporate and investor clients producing actionable investment research based on our deep-dive analysis of public policy.
